In her extended introduction, Nagle offers illuminating information and commentary . . . This verse translation, internally glossed for clarification, is as accurate as modern English will allow. . . . Highly recommended. --Choice
An excellent rendition in English of Ovid's poetic calendar of the Roman religious year, with an original introduction and useful notes as well as a glossary . . . The translation is elegant and geared to the modern reader. --The Journal of Indo-European Studies
This elegant translation brings Ovid's poetic calendar of the Roman religious year to a new generation of students and scholars. A valuable source of information about the Roman calendar, it complements Ovid's masterwork, the Metamorphoses.

About the Author
BETTY ROSE NAGLE, Associate Professor of Classical Studies at Indiana University, is author of The Poetics of Exile and numerous articles on Roman literature.
